diff options
author | joe <joe@61a7d7f5-40b7-0310-9c16-bb0ea8cb1845> | 2007-06-27 13:40:07 +0000 |
---|---|---|
committer | joe <joe@61a7d7f5-40b7-0310-9c16-bb0ea8cb1845> | 2007-06-27 13:40:07 +0000 |
commit | d74e2ecc1a3838628a8cb70de2125ccec0385d74 (patch) | |
tree | f01ffed537213dd540f793c2cfefa98fc93e352c | |
parent | 1f36c9829c542e0dd77cf56dc012720046a1848a (diff) | |
download | neon-d74e2ecc1a3838628a8cb70de2125ccec0385d74.tar.gz |
* src/ne_gnutls.c (pkcs12_parse, ne_ssl_clicert_read): Remove
now-redundant code on encrypted-cert path.
git-svn-id: http://svn.webdav.org/repos/projects/neon/trunk@1172 61a7d7f5-40b7-0310-9c16-bb0ea8cb1845
-rw-r--r-- | src/ne_gnutls.c | 13 |
1 files changed, 4 insertions, 9 deletions
diff --git a/src/ne_gnutls.c b/src/ne_gnutls.c index ab88622..4820b6a 100644 --- a/src/ne_gnutls.c +++ b/src/ne_gnutls.c @@ -896,15 +896,10 @@ ne_ssl_client_cert *ne_ssl_clicert_read(const char *filename) cc->p12 = NULL; return cc; } else { - if (ret == 0) { - cc = ne_calloc(sizeof *cc); - cc->friendly_name = NULL; - cc->p12 = p12; - return cc; - } else { - gnutls_pkcs12_deinit(p12); - return NULL; - } + cc = ne_calloc(sizeof *cc); + cc->friendly_name = NULL; + cc->p12 = p12; + return cc; } } |